Factors to Consider When Choosing Central Vacuum Kits For Diy Installation

Choosing the right central vacuum kit for DIY installation involves more than just pipe length or price. It’s essential to consider how easy the system is to assemble, how adaptable it is to your home’s layout, and whether the included components meet your cleaning needs. A well-chosen kit will save you time and frustration, providing long-term convenience. This guide explores key factors to help you make an informed decision and avoid common pitfalls that can turn a DIY project into a costly or incomplete setup.

Pipe Length and Home Size

Matching the pipe length to your home’s size is critical. Longer pipes reduce the need for additional fittings or extensions, making installation smoother and more seamless. However, excessively long pipes can increase costs and complexity for smaller homes. Consider your floor plan carefully—most standard kits with 35-50 feet of pipe suit medium-sized homes, while larger residences may require extended setups. Keep in mind that longer pipe runs can also affect airflow efficiency if not properly designed.

Ease of Installation

Look for kits that feature straightforward assembly with clear instructions. Components like quick-connect fittings, pre-cut pipes, and modular designs help reduce setup time. Kits that include detailed diagrams or video tutorials can make a significant difference, especially if you’re new to DIY projects. Avoid overly complex systems with numerous fittings or proprietary parts that might complicate the installation process and increase the risk of errors.

Included Accessories and Compatibility

Accessories such as hoses, brushes, and extension wands enhance the system’s usability. Check whether the kit provides these essentials or if you’ll need to purchase them separately. Compatibility with existing fixtures or wiring can also save time and money. Think about future needs—if you plan to expand the system or upgrade components later, ensure the kit is adaptable to those modifications.

Build Quality and Material Durability

Durability matters when installing a system that will last for years. PVC pipes are common for their affordability and ease of handling, but higher-grade materials may offer better longevity and airflow. Fittings and connectors should be sturdy and designed for repeated assembly and disassembly. Investing in quality components can prevent leaks, reduce maintenance, and ensure consistent performance.

Budget and Long-Term Value

While lower-cost kits might seem appealing, they can sometimes compromise on pipe length, accessories, or build quality, leading to additional expenses down the line. Consider the total cost of ownership—an investment in a higher-quality kit with ample pipe coverage and accessories may pay off through easier installation and more effective cleaning. Balance your budget with your home’s needs to find a setup that offers the best value without sacrificing quality.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I install a central vacuum system myself without prior experience?

Yes, many homeowners successfully install central vacuum systems on their own, especially with kits designed for DIY use. Kits that include clear instructions, modular components, and straightforward fittings make the process more manageable. However, it’s important to assess your comfort with basic plumbing and electrical tasks, as some systems may require minor wiring or wall modifications. Taking your time, following manufacturer instructions carefully, and consulting online tutorials can help ensure a smooth installation.

What pipe length do I need for a typical home?

For most average-sized homes, a pipe run of around 35 to 50 feet will generally suffice to cover all main areas. Larger homes may require extended piping or multiple inlets to reach every room efficiently. It’s advisable to measure your space and plan the layout before purchasing, ensuring your kit includes enough pipe length. Overestimating slightly can prevent the need for additional fittings or extensions later on.

Are accessories like hoses and brushes included in most DIY kits?

Many kits come with basic hoses and brushes, but the quality and quantity can vary. Some budget options include only essential fittings, requiring you to buy accessories separately. If you want a more complete setup, look for kits that bundle hoses, extension wands, and variety of brushes. Upgrading accessories later is possible, but choosing a kit with quality included parts can save time and improve overall cleaning performance.

How do I know if a kit is compatible with my home’s wiring and fixtures?

Compatibility depends on the system’s specifications and your home’s existing electrical wiring and wall outlets. Many kits are designed with universal fittings and low-voltage wiring that work with standard wall switches. To avoid surprises, review the product details carefully and compare them with your home’s setup. If in doubt, consulting a professional or reading user reviews can help clarify compatibility issues.

What is the typical lifespan of a central vacuum system installed DIY?

With proper installation and routine maintenance, a centrally installed vacuum system can last 15-20 years or longer. Quality components and durable piping materials contribute to longevity. Regularly cleaning filters, inspecting fittings, and replacing worn accessories will extend the system’s service life. Investing in reputable brands and high-quality parts at the outset can help maximize your system’s durability and performance over time.
